table.fields {
	margin: 0 0 8px 0;
}
div.field {
	margin: 4px 8px 8px 8px;
}

div.field label {
	line-height: 1.6;
}

div.field span.required {
	color: #c44141;
}

div.field span.value,
div.field div.value {
	display: block;
	line-height: 20px;
	padding: 2px;
}

div.field ul.error li {
	font-size: 12px;
	color: #c44141;
	font-weight: bold;
}

div.field span.note {
	font-size: 11px;
}

input.long,
input.half,
input.mini,
input.sub,
textarea {
	padding: 1px 2px;
}

input.long,
textarea.long {
	width: 656px;
}

input.half,
textarea.half {
	width: 317px;
}

textarea.half {
	height:132px;
}
input.mini {
	width: 204px;
}

input.sub,
textarea.sub {
	width: 260px;
}

textarea.template {
	width: 100%;
	font-size: 12px;
	font-family: monospace;
}

table.buttons tr td {
	padding: 4px 8px;
}

input.button {
	padding-left: 16px;
	padding-right: 16px;
}

table.meta tr td {
	padding: 4px 8px;
}
table.meta tr th {
	color: #666666;
}
